"A stable economic base strengthens Indonesia's position on the global stage and supports our sustainable active role. To maintain this role, Indonesia must be able to secure its own future. This is where economic self-reliance becomes critically important. Diversification of partners is carried out with an understanding of the need to reduce risks amid the instability and slowdown of our traditional partners' economies," Sugiono said in an annual address.
In a 'transactional' world, BRICS creates space for cooperation among Global South countries and strengthens common resilience, the minister added.
